Re: P1456? loose gas cap??

if it isnt the gas cap, something else is letting out the gas tank pressure. a line could be busted or loose, the vent solenoid could be stuck open (depending on what code it is) or the vapor canister could be leaking. the system should be smoked or pressure tested to find the leak. There is an EVAP service port marked with a green tag near the throttle body. a shop connects a smoke machine or pressure tester to that port while a technician searches or listens for signs of leakage. There really isnt one part you can change to make the light go away. and youre only getting the code when the monitor runs, which explains the delay between reseting and the MIL setting. i think if you drive around with less than 1/3 of a tank of gas all the time, it wont ever run, but you dont want to do that forever.

Re: P1456? loose gas cap??

P1456 EVAP Emissions Control System Leak Detected (Fuel Tank System)

Control Canister System is P1457

and Purge Flow Switch Malfunction is P1459
